Eleazar officially assumes PNP Chief post
(Eagle News) — Police Lt. Gen. Guillermo Eleazar on Friday, May 7, formally assumed the post of Philippine National Police chief, becoming the sixth person to be appointed to the post by President Rodrigo Duterte. Eleazar, who finished fourth in the Philippine Military Academy ‘Hinirang’ Class of 1987, replaced Police General Debold Sinas, who will reach the mandatory age of retirement on Saturday, May 8. Año recommends Cascolan, Eleazar, Gamboa to Duterte for PNP chief post
(Eagle News)–Interior Secretary Eduardo Año has recommended three police officials to the post of Philippine National Police chief to President Rodrigo Duterte. Año has recommended Police Lieutenant General Camilo Pancratius Cascolan, Police Major General Guillermo Eleazar and Police Lieutenant General Archie Francisco Gamboa to the post vacated by Oscar Albayalde following allegations he intervened in the cases filed against 13 of his men who were behind an irregular drug raid in Pampanga in 2013.
